Background technique
Cable:Usually by several or several groups of conducting wires form.Cable has power cable, control cable, compensating cable, shielding Cable, high-temperature cable, computer cable, signal cable, coaxial cable, fire-resisting cable, cable for ship, mine cable, aluminium alloy Cable etc..They are all made of sub-thread or stranded conductor and insulating layer, for connecting circuit, electric appliance etc..Cable is according to light The system of overhead utility can be divided into direct current cables and ac cable.The manufacture and the production method of most of electronic products of wire and cable It is entirely different.Electronic product generallys use another part being assembled into component, multiple components refill and are made into separate unit product, product with Number of units or number of packages metering.Wire and cable is with length for basic measurement unit.All wire and cables be all since conductor processing, Wire and cable product is made plus insulation, shielding, stranding, sheath etc. layer by layer in the periphery of conductor.Product structure is got over The level of complexity, superposition is more.
All be that screw-type is wound on online roller after cable machine-shaping at present, due to pull build during same direction The cable that cannot close very much the winding of matching thread type is pullled, and then be easy to cause and mutually winds random line, causes venting efficiency is low to ask Topic.

Please refer to Fig. 1-5, a kind of power cable actinobacillus device of anti-random line, including winding roller 1, fixed frame 3, first threading Hole 4 and limiting device 7,1 left pivot movement of winding roller are fixed in the fixed plate 2 of left side, and rotation is fixed on the right side on the right side of winding roller 1 In side fixed plate 19, winding roller 1 and right side fixed plate 19 and winding roller 1 and left side fixed plate 2 are connected by bearing, left side Fixed plate 2 and 19 lower end of right side fixed plate are fixed on bottom plate 8, and 8 lower end of bottom plate is fixed, and there are four the branch of rectangular array distribution Stake pad 9,9 lower end of supporting pad are equipped with the anti-skid bulge of array distribution, the ball-type of array distribution are equipped with inside first threading hole 4 Chamber 27 is equipped with ball 28 inside ball-type chamber 27, and ball-type chamber 27 and 28 surface of ball are designed with one layer of smooth wear-resistant material, and One threading hole, 4 lower end is fixed on upper support bar 5, and 5 lower end of upper support bar is interspersed in inside outer tube 6, upper support bar 5 and housing Pipe 6 is fixed by fixed pin, cooperates fixed pin to be equipped with the fixation hole of array distribution on upper support bar 5,6 lower end of outer tube is interspersed in In limiting slot 10,10 lower end of limiting slot is fixed on bottom plate 8, and outer tube 6 is equipped with slide plate, slide plate and limit inside limiting slot 10 Slot 10 is fixed by symmetrically arranged two spacer pins, and spacer pin is cooperated to be equipped with the limit hole of array distribution, institute on limiting slot 10 It states fixed frame 3 to be fixed on bottom plate 8,3 upper slide bar of fixed frame, the lower end of the slider is fixed by support column, and support column is symmetrically arranged with Two, support column lower end is fixed on bottom plate 8, and casing 21 is arranged on slide bar, and 21 upper end of casing is fixed with the second threading hole 20, Second threading hole 20 is equipped with and the identical structure of the first threading hole 4, and push rod 22 is fixed with inside casing 21, and the setting of push rod 22 is in L Type, push rod 22 are limited by position-limiting tube 23, and position-limiting tube 23 is fixed on slide bar, and the setting of position-limiting tube 23 is mounted on slide bar from right to left At a quarter, 22 right end of push rod is fixed on tooth frame 17, and upper tooth 25 and lower tooth 26 are equipped with inside tooth frame 17, and the upper setting of tooth 25 exists On the upside of lower tooth 26, incomplete tooth 18 is equipped with inside tooth frame 17, the incomplete setting of tooth 18 is alternately engaged with upper tooth 25 and lower tooth 26, no Complete tooth 18 is fixed in shaft 24, and shaft 24 is interspersed in inside gear-box 16, and gear-box 16 is fixed in the fixed plate 19 of right side, The first conical tooth 29 is fixed in shaft 24 inside gear-box 16, the first conical tooth 29 and the second conical tooth 30 engage, and second Conical tooth 30 is fixed on the rotating shaft, and rotation axis is fixed on the central axis of winding roller 1, and the limiting device 7 is fixed on bottom plate 8 On, there are four the settings of limiting device 7 and rectangular array is distributed, and limiting device 7 is equipped with fixed plate 13, and fixed plate 13 is fixed on On bottom plate 8, fixed plate 13 is internally threaded pipe 12, and threaded rod 14 is interspersed with inside screwed pipe 12, and 14 upper end of threaded rod is fixed There is handle 15,15 surface of handle is equipped with one layer of rubber pad, and the rotation of 14 lower end of threaded rod is fixed with sucker 11, when using unwrapping wire, electricity Cable is inserted through the second threading hole 20 and the first threading hole 4 carries out unwrapping wire, is arranged inside the second threading hole 20 and the first threading hole 4 Ball 28 can avoid cable and worn during pulling, during unwrapping wire, cable drives winding roller 1 to rotate, and winding roller 1 passes through Rotation axis and the second conical tooth 30 drive the first conical tooth 29 and shaft 24 to rotate, and shaft 24 drives incomplete tooth 18 and upper tooth 25 It is alternately engaged with lower tooth 26, and then realizes 17 bilateral reciprocation of tooth frame, tooth frame 17 drives the second threading hole 20 by push rod 22 Bilateral reciprocation realizes the cable drum of the second threading hole 20 cooperation screw type coiling, and avoiding same direction from pulling line cannot be very The problem of cable drum of good combination screw type coiling is easy to cause random line, venting efficiency is high, the suction being arranged on limiting device 7 Disk 11 is conducive to fixing-stable.
The working principle of the invention is:The power cable actinobacillus device of the anti-random line of the present invention, when using unwrapping wire, cable is interspersed Unwrapping wire, the ball being arranged inside the second threading hole 20 and the first threading hole 4 are carried out by the second threading hole 20 and the first threading hole 4 28 avoidable cables are worn during pulling, and during unwrapping wire, cable drives winding roller 1 to rotate, and winding roller 1 passes through rotation axis The first conical tooth 29 and shaft 24 is driven to rotate with the second conical tooth 30, shaft 24 drives incomplete tooth 18 and upper tooth 25 and lower tooth 26 alternately engage, and then realize 17 bilateral reciprocation of tooth frame, and tooth frame 17 drives the second threading hole 20 or so past by push rod 22 The cable drum of the second threading hole 20 cooperation screw type coiling is realized in multiple movement, and avoiding same direction from pulling line cannot tie well The problem of cable drum of conjunction screw type coiling is easy to cause random line, venting efficiency is high, and the sucker 11 being arranged on limiting device 7 has Conducive to fixing-stable.
